Help AMASA to support Cotlands Baby Sanctuary

Each year the Advertising Media Association of SA (AMASA) selects a charity to benefit from the generosity of its committee, members and supporters, and this year AMASA has elected to support Cotlands Baby Sanctuary who are celebrating 67 years of service.

As one of South Africa's biggest independent, non-profit organisations, caring for South African children in distress as well as those abandoned and abused children infected with HIV/AIDS AMASA encourages you to show your support.
